Frequently asked questions
Is this tray made from durable stainless steel?
Yes, the Mayo Tray is crafted from high-grade stainless steel, specifically engineered to withstand the rigorous demands of professional clinical environments while resisting wear.
Can this tray be reused after sterilization?
Absolutely. This tray is a reusable instrument, built to endure repeated sterilization cycles, making it a reliable, long-term solution for surgical suites.
Does this tray contain any latex materials?
No, the product is not made with natural rubber latex, ensuring it is safe for use in environments where latex sensitivities are a concern.
Is the surface solid or perforated?
This model features a solid, non-perforated surface, providing a clean, flat platform that is ideal for effectively managing and organizing surgical tools.
Will this tray fit standard surgical Mayo stands?
With dimensions of 13-1/2” x 9-3/4” x 3/4”, this tray is designed to integrate seamlessly with standard Mayo stands, keeping your instruments elevated and within the sterile field.
Are the edges designed to keep tools contained?
Yes, the tray is manufactured with a raised edge/rim, which provides structural rigidity and ensures instruments remain safely contained during surgical procedures.
Is this tray suitable for high-pressure clinical use?
Yes. Because it is built for professional medical settings, it is designed for surgical efficiency, helping scrub technologists maintain an organized and accessible setup throughout operations.
Does this tray come sterile upon arrival?
The tray is delivered non-sterile. Users are expected to follow their facility’s standard protocols for cleaning and sterilization before the first use.
How long will this professional-grade tray last?
The Sklar Mayo Tray is built to last a lifetime. It is backed by a lifetime warranty, reflecting the high manufacturing standards and durability required for surgical equipment.
What is the model number for this specific tray?
This is the model 10-1691, known for its solid construction and precise sizing for medical instrument management.
